Urban redevelopment is a complex process that aims to revitalize and improve urban areas to meet the changing needs of society. Traditional methods of urban redevelopment typically involve government interventions, private investments, and community engagement. However, the advent of Blockchain technology is revolutionizing the way urban redevelopment projects are planned, funded, and executed. Blockchain technology, most commonly known for its association with cryptocurrencies like Bitcoin, is a decentralized and transparent digital ledger that securely records transactions across multiple computers. This technology has the potential to streamline the urban redevelopment process by enhancing transparency, security, and efficiency. One of the key benefits of blockchain technology in urban redevelopment is its ability to facilitate secure and transparent transactions. By using blockchain, stakeholders in redevelopment projects can securely exchange value without the need for intermediaries, reducing the risk of fraud and corruption. Additionally, blockchain can enhance transparency by providing a permanent and tamper-proof record of all transactions, making it easier to track the flow of funds and ensure accountability. Furthermore, blockchain technology can streamline the fundraising process for urban redevelopment projects through the use of digital tokens or "smart contracts." These digital tokens represent ownership of assets or securities and can be traded on blockchain platforms, allowing developers to access a broader pool of investors and raise capital more efficiently. Smart contracts, self-executing contracts with the terms of the agreement directly written into code, can automate the process of distributing funds, ensuring that funds are released only when certain conditions are met. In the context of economic welfare theory, blockchain technology can contribute to the overall well-being of society by promoting a more inclusive and equitable urban redevelopment process. The transparency and efficiency offered by blockchain can foster greater trust among stakeholders and create opportunities for broader participation in redevelopment projects, particularly for marginalized communities. By democratizing access to investment opportunities and streamlining the development process, blockchain has the potential to create more sustainable and socially responsible urban environments. In conclusion, blockchain technology holds great promise as a catalyst for urban redevelopment and economic welfare. By enhancing transparency, security, and efficiency in the redevelopment process, blockchain can help create vibrant and inclusive urban spaces that benefit the well-being of all. As the technology continues to evolve, it is essential for policymakers, developers, and communities to explore the potential of blockchain in shaping the future of urban development.
